Warning Signs You Need Groundwater Seepage Removal
Catching the signs of groundwater seepage early can save you thousands of dollars in repairs and prevent serious health hazards. Here are some common warning signs to look out for: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Strong, persistent musty odors can show the presence of mold and mildew. If you notice these smells in your home, it’s essential to investigate further to find out the source and extent of the issue.
Water Stains on Ceilings and Walls
Visible water stains or discoloration on your ceilings and walls can be a sign of seepage. If you notice these stains, contact our team immediately to schedule an assessment and repair.
Cracking and Warping of Wooden Floors
Cracking and warping of wooden floors can be a sign of excessive moisture. If you notice these issues, it’s essential to address them quickly to prevent further damage and potential health hazards.
Mold Growth and Fungi
Mold growth and fungi can thrive in damp environments. If you notice these signs, contact our team immediately to schedule an assessment and remediation.
Unexplained Puddles or Water Accumulation
Unexplained puddles or water accumulation in your home can be a sign of seepage. If you notice these issues, contact our team immediately to schedule an assessment and repair.
Bubbling or Cracking in Paint or Wallpaper
Bubbling or cracking in paint or wallpaper can be a sign of excessive moisture. If you notice these issues, contact our team immediately to schedule an assessment and repair.
Groundwater Seepage Removal v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small area of water damage | Yes | No | DIY solutions are usually effective for small areas of water damage. |
| Visible signs of mold or mildew | No | Yes | DIY solutions may not be effective in removing mold and mildew, and can spread the problem further. |
| Structural damage to walls or floors | No | Yes | Structural damage needs professional expertise to assess and repair safely. |
| High levels of water damage | No | Yes | High levels of water damage need specialized equipment and expertise to safely and effectively dry and repair. |
| Unknown source of water damage | No | Yes | A professional assessment is necessary to identify the source and extent of the water damage. |

Groundwater Seepage Removal Cost In Mckenna, WA
The cost of groundwater seepage removal in Mckenna, WA, can vary depending on the severity of the issue,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our team offers free estimates to ensure you have a clear understanding of the costs involved. We’ll work closely with you to develop a customized solution that meets your needs and budget.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Assessment and Inspection | $200 – $500 | Size of the affected area and complexity of the issue |
| Water Removal and Containment | $500 – $2,000 | Volume of water and equipment required |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$1,000 – $3,000 | Size of the affected area and equipment required |
| Repair and Reconstruction | $2,000 – $5,000 | Scope of repairs and materials required |
| Final Inspection and Quality Control | $200 – $500 | Complexity of the issue and extent of repairs |
